Pet Stylist Salary in the United States

How much does a Pet Stylist make in the United States?

As of May 01, 2026, the average salary for a Pet Stylist in the United States is $39,303 per year, which breaks down to an hourly rate of $19.

However, a Pet Stylist's salary can vary significantly. Here’s a look at the typical salary range:

  • Top Earners (90th percentile): $57,834
  • Majority Range (25th-75th percentile): $32,103 to $49,003
  • Entry-Level (10th percentile): $25,548

3. Can a cosmetologist be a dog groomer?

Yes, a cosmetologist can become a dog groomer, but they must complete a Grooming Salon Apprentice program for certification. Experience and training are essential, along with passing a three-part practical grooming test. Pet stylists typically earn between $31,203 and $47,703 annually, with a mid-salary of $38,203.

4. Can dog groomers make 100k a year?

While some dog groomers may aspire to earn $100,000 a year, typical salaries for pet stylists range from $31,203 to $47,703, with a mid-range salary of $38,203. Earnings can vary significantly based on factors like clientele and location, but reaching six figures is generally uncommon for most groomers.
